What is Estate Planning?
Estate planning is the process of arranging and managing your assets so that they are distributed according to your wishes after you pass away This includes making decisions about how your property, finances, and other assets will be divided among your loved ones Estate planning also involves taking steps to minimize estate taxes and potential legal issues that may arise after your death.

How to Start Estate Planning in Bristol
If you are considering estate planning in Bristol, the first step is to gather information about your assets and liabilities This includes creating a list of your bank accounts, investments, real estate properties, vehicles, and other valuable assets You should also make a list of your debts, such as mortgages, loans, and credit card balances.
Next, you should think about how you would like your assets to be distributed after your death Consider who you would like to inherit your property, finances, and personal belongings, and make a plan for how these assets will be divided You may also want to designate beneficiaries for your retirement accounts, life insurance policies, and other assets that pass outside of your estate.
Once you have a clear understanding of your assets and goals, you should work with an experienced estate planning professional in Bristol An estate planning lawyer can help you create a comprehensive estate plan that reflects your wishes and complies with the relevant laws and regulations They can also assist you in setting up trusts, drafting wills, and designating powers of attorney to ensure that your estate is managed according to your instructions.
